Die Worth (Kaiserworth Hotel) by Childish
Kaiserworth is definitely the most impressive building in the town with this mixture of styles on its facade, especially with the golden Baroque figures. There are 8 figures of the German emperors who contributed to the growth of the Imperial town of Goslar.
It was built in 1494 as a gild house of the cloth merchants who were at the time the most influential and richest citizen and who were impatient with the building of the city hall.
Nowadays the building is a hotel for 200 years already.
